Output 6ed18d149628ce341313a161f771a6446c6e57af17d9e83f11752686069d737c:0

value
43638000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5eba8fdf522807a7e6520fec5a84777feeac7e38 OP_EQUALVERIFY OP_CHECKSIG
address
19dt1b4DTx7UGgM8PD4PkSA4vwPYNzCP29
transaction
6ed18d149628ce341313a161f771a6446c6e57af17d9e83f11752686069d737c
spent
true